| Communications Officer (Humanitarian Aid) | Develops and implements communication strategies for humanitarian crises, managing media relations and public information. High demand for crisis communication skills. |
| Public Relations Manager (International Aid) | Leads PR efforts for NGOs and international aid organizations, building relationships with stakeholders and managing reputation during crises. Requires strong crisis management expertise. |
| Digital Humanitarian (Social Media & Crisis Response) | Utilizes digital platforms for crisis communication and information dissemination, managing online narratives and engaging with affected communities. Growing demand for digital skills in the humanitarian sector. |
| Crisis Communication Consultant (International Development) | Provides expert advice and support to organizations on crisis communication planning, training, and response. High level of experience and specialized knowledge required. |
